Internal Memo — Finance Team

Re: Churn in the Fernbrook Pilot

Churn in the Fernbrook pilot hit 9.4% last month, up from 6.1% at launch. Exit surveys point to onboarding friction rather than pricing; most departures occur in the first three weeks. Revenue impact this quarter is modest, roughly within contingency, but the trend would erode the full-year case if it continues. Ops is trialling a guided setup flow, and we will re-baseline forecasts once two months of post-fix data are in. Please treat the following with discretion.

internal memo for kaduf-baduf: Only 35 of the 378 pilot accounts renewed Holir, so a churn review is set for June 11. Eliielax Group is in early talks to buy Silaelix Group for about $142.1 million.

Attending: Brask, Onora, Felwin. Purpose: brief the incoming director on the revised sales-commission scheme. Decisions: tiered rates replace flat 5%; accelerators begin at 110% of quota; clawbacks apply to cancellations within 90 days. Rollout: pilot in the Marrow Bay branch from April, firm-wide by July. Onora owns comms; Felwin owns payroll changes. Objections from the field team were noted and deferred. Full modelling is attached. The underlying strategy is summarised in the confidential note below.

board note of tadup-tajog: Headcount on the Oliiel team goes from 31 to 88 by the end of February. Gross margin on Oliiel came in at 62 percent against a plan of 29 percent.

## Limits and quotas: resolver batching

After the N+1 fix in the Tarnwell GraphQL layer, nested resolvers batch their fetches through a shared dataloader instead of issuing one query per parent row. This cut database round trips dramatically, but it introduced new ceilings: batch size, queue flush interval, and a per-request loader cap. Exceeding the cap aborts the request with a partial-result error, so raise it deliberately and document why. The current values, enforced at startup, are listed below.

tuning constants:
RATE_LIMITS = {
    "wenwyn": 1,
    "zorix": 10,
    "oliix": 2,
    "holael": 10,
}